HARRISBURG, Pa. (WHTM) – A man on Pennsylvania State Police – Harrisburg’s Top 5 Most Wanted has been captured by U.S. Marshals. The Marshals’ Fugitive Task Force arrested Chrishawn Quailes-Baskerville, 19, who was wanted on firearms and aggravated assault charges after State Police say he fled a Harrisburg traffic stop in May.

Hundreds of mourners at funeral say goodbye to Corey Comperatore
BUFFALO TOWNSHIP, Pa. (KDKA) — Hundreds of mourners came together in Buffalo Township to pay their last respects to Corey Comperatore, the man killed at the rally for former President Donald Trump on Saturday. Countless firetrucks and motorcycles from all over made their way down Route 356 in Butler County in honor of Comperatore, whose casket was draped in an American flag as it sat on top of one of those firetrucks. Friday's private service happened at Cabot United Methodist Church, where Comperatore was a lifelong member. "A death like that is not easy," one mourner said. Harrisburg man sentenced for threatening to kill government employees
HARRISBURG, Pa. — A Harrisburg man has been sentenced to time served plus probation for sending a series of threatening emails to government employees. According to the United States Attorney's Office for the Middle District of Pennsylvania, Thomas West, 44, was sentenced for sending an interstate communication containing a threat. West had already been in custody for over five months and was sentenced to time served and a one-year term of supervised release.

Police seek help identifying suspected Stanley cup stealers
HARRISBURG, Pa. — Police in Dauphin County are searching for a trio of suspected Stanley stealers. The women are accused of taking approximately $4,000 worth of Stanley cup and Bogg bag merchandise from a Dick's Sporting Goods store on the 5000 block of Jonestown Road in Lower Paxton Township.
